However, the medium that carries the traffic is constantly changing. Before the 21st century, the Little Tigers and the Four Heavenly Kings were born, and the driving force behind star-making mainly came from the record companies or film and television production companies behind them.
After the 21st century, the power of star-making was gradually released into the hands of the mass media, which also gave birth to the four-wheeled idol industry or star-making wave in China. From 2003 to 2007, the era of TV draft represented by Super Girl Fast Boy. After 2008, a series of imitation Korean eras that imitated the Korean star-making model were launched, including sms marketing service Tianyu. Since 2012, local incubation and talent show variety shows have given birth to SNH48, TF-boys, Cai Xukun, Rocket Girls, etc. Almost parallel to the third wave, since 2014, the right to speak on the live broadcast platform has been increasing, and the leading anchors have become stars, such as the Modern Brothers,
